Gary Allan Personal Life
Gary Allan Herzberg's upbringing took place in La Mirada, California, under the care of his parents, Harley and Mary Herzberg. Raised in a Mormon household, his mother had a unique way of ensuring the family's devotion to music by keeping their guitars prominently displayed at home. At the tender age of 13, Gary Allan started performing in honky tonks alongside his father.
Remarkably, just two years later, he received his first recording contract offer from A&M Records. However, he turned down the opportunity at that time. This decision was influenced by his parents' desire for him to complete his education, and his father believed that Allan had yet to refine his distinctive musical style.
Despite his commitment to finishing his education, Allan candidly admits that he often found himself disengaged in the classroom. His nights were occupied with performing in bars, which left him feeling half-asleep during his school days. In his words, he thought that sleep was what you did when you went to school.

Gary Allan Career
Gary Allan's musical journey took root in the early 1990s when he began his career by performing at honky-tonk bars and clubs across California. In 1995, he inked a deal with Decca Records, and the following year, he unveiled his debut album, "Used Heart for Sale." His sophomore effort, "It Would Be You," graced the music scene in 1998, giving rise to two hit singles, "It Would Be You" and "No Man in His Wrong Heart."
Over the subsequent decades, Allan continued to make waves in the music industry, consistently delivering successful albums and producing hit singles. Among his most beloved tracks are "Man to Man," "The One," "Watching Airplanes," and "Every Storm (Runs Out of Rain)." He has garnered praise for his distinctive vocal prowess and his adeptness in seamlessly blending traditional country elements with rock and pop influences.
